Create a Java program titled "Product Inventory Management.java" that begins by initializing an array of 40 strings, representing product names in a store inventory. The product names are: "Laptop", "Camera", "Headphones", "Printer", "Smartphone", "Tablet", "Mouse", "Keyboard", "Monitor", "External Hard Drive", "Router", "Speaker", "Microphone", "Graphic Tablet", "Flash Drive", "Fitness Tracker", "Smartwatch", "Bluetooth Earbuds", "Gaming Console", "TV", "Air Purifier", "Coffee Maker", "Blender", "Toaster", "Vacuum Cleaner", "Hair Dryer", "Electric Shaver", "Refrigerator", "Washing Machine", "Dishwasher", "Microwave Oven", "Steam Iron", "Coffee Grinder","Juicer", "Hand Mixer", "Curling Iron", "Electric Toothbrush", "Digital Camera". (a) Prompt the user for a target product name (Key) and pass the value, the array, and the size of the array to a function implementing the linear or sequential search algorithm. The function should count the number of comparisons until it finds the value and return the count to the main function. (b) Call a function that utilizes the selection sort algorithm to sort the given array in alphabetical order. (c) Call a function that employs the binary search algorithm to locate the same target product name (Key). Pass the value, the sorted array, and the size of the array to this function. The function should track the number of comparisons and return this count to the main function. Display the number of comparisons for both search functions in the main with appropriate messages.
